.NET Micro Framework 开发板快速入门指南

4星 · 超过85%的资源 需积分: 10 34 下载量 153 浏览量 更新于2024-08-01 1 收藏 1.32MB PDF 举报
".Net Micro Framework开发板用户简明手册" 本文档主要介绍了.NET Micro Framework (简称.Net MF) 开发板的使用,旨在帮助初学者快速掌握这一技术。.NET Micro Framework 是微软为小型、资源受限的设备设计的一种操作系统平台,它结合了.NET的稳定性和效率以及Visual Studio的高效开发环境,使得开发者能够使用熟悉的工具创建嵌入式应用程序。 1. .NET Micro Framework 应用场景 .NET Micro Framework 广泛应用于各种领域,如Sideshow、遥控系统、智能家居、医疗电子、教育设备、销售终端和汽车电子。在物联网时代,由于其支持多种通信接口(如串口、网口、Wi-Fi、Zigbee、I2C、SPI、SDIO和USB),且开发流程简便,因此在连接设备中具有很大潜力。 2. .NET Micro Framework 与Window CE和Windows XP Embedded 的区别 与Windows Embedded CE和Windows XP Embedded相比,.NET Micro Framework 对硬件资源的需求更低。它能在不支持MMU的ARM7、ARM9、Blackfin和Cortex-M3等低成本、低功耗处理器上运行,所需的RAM和Flash/ROM空间远小于Windows Embedded CE的托管代码环境。这降低了产品的成本,使其更适合于资源有限的设备。 3. .NET Micro Framework与其他.NET平台的差异 .NET Micro Framework 是.NET家族的一个分支,专为超轻量级平台设计。不同于.NET Framework和.NET Compact Framework,.NET Micro Framework 具备自动启动功能,并且在硬件抽象层(HAL)中集成了操作系统的关键功能,如启动管理、中断处理、线程调度和内存管理。这种设计使得它能在非常小的内存空间中运行,同时保持高效。 4. 开发工具与支持 为了帮助开发者,微软提供了Visual Studio工具链,使得开发者能够在熟悉的环境中编写、调试和部署.NET Micro Framework应用程序。此外,文档中提到的博客和联系信息为用户提供了一个学习和交流的平台,例如叶帆工作室在CSDN、博客园和51CTO上的博客,以及作者的MSN联系方式,这些都是获取帮助和学习资源的途径。 .NET Micro Framework提供了一个强大的平台,用于开发小型、嵌入式和物联网应用。通过理解其特点和与其他.NET平台的差异,开发者能够更有效地利用这个工具进行创新设计和实现。